Related occupations
Explore related occupations in the apprentice carpenter sector.
Apprentice Joiner
An Apprentice Joiner creates timber components like doors and staircases, installs them under a qualified joiner, and needs teamwork and attention to detail.
Apprentice Cabinet Maker
An Apprentice Cabinet Maker builds and installs cabinets, follows designs, takes measurements, and trains under guidance, needing accuracy and teamwork.
Apprentice Furniture Maker
An Apprentice Furniture Maker builds furniture from timber and synthetic materials, designs pieces with clients, and requires detail and teamwork.
Furniture Polisher
A Furniture Polisher finishes furniture by applying coatings, preparing surfaces, and using various materials while ensuring attention to detail.
Wood Machinist
A Wood Machinist shapes timber into specific pieces, using tools for cutting and finishing, while ensuring high-quality production and customer service.
Carpenter
A Carpenter in Australia constructs and repairs wooden structures, interprets blueprints, measures materials, and collaborates on various projects, ensuring compliance with safety standards.
Formwork Carpenter
A Formwork Carpenter constructs temporary timber or concrete moulds for large or small construction projects, working outdoors in varied weather.
Shopfitter
A Shopfitter constructs and installs fixtures like shelves and counters in commercial spaces, following plans and ensuring quality workmanship.
